i was reading an article about an exchange between Israeli and Lebanese soldiers, and was amazed. It was during the actual conflict. An Israeli unit took control of a Lebanese town with a mostly christian population, and the Lebanese outpost there surrendered before any shots were fired. There is a video in which the Israelis are being given tea by the Lebanese, which included a General, and had a cordial conversation. Hezbollah is pissed about it, and the Lebanese General commanding the base has been arrested since Lebanon does not recognize Israel and are forbidden contact with Israelis. Here is the dialogue.


At one point in the video, Daoud and an Israeli soldier have the following exchange, as translated by CNN's Octavia Nasr:

Daoud: "Don't we need to tell our bosses?"

Israeli soldier: "Tell whoever you want."

Daoud: "We need to brief them on what happened."

Israeli soldier: "We briefed (U.S. President) Bush. You brief whoever you want."

Daoud: "We need to brief Bush too."
